Lead Theft from Llandrindod Wells Church Roof

Mon, 30/10/2017

Owing to their size, history, and relative isolation, churches are often targets for metal roof theft. One of our more recent call-outs was to a beautiful church in Llandrindod Wells in Mid Wales, which had had large amounts of lead stolen including nearly all of its lead elevations.

For many in this situation, the idea of reroofing using lead can feel both expensive and pointless (metal thieves may just take it again) 

Polymer roofing provides an theftproof (anti-theft) roof which mimics the look of lead so accurately that it is also known as "liquid lead", allowing churches and other historic buildings to retain a beautiful traditional look without further risk of theft.
